They usually get pretty hungry after a few days. You can do a test by putting a piece of banana, squash, or a slice of bread in the bin and see what they do. My bugs go NUTS over those so if they're hungry they'll dig right in and the issue may be the chow. If they ignore those too, they may just not be hungry at the moment.
Yeah oranges are another favorite. How is the temperature in the bin? Are they moving around a bit or are they congregated somewhere or buried in the frass? They tend to get a bit more active in the 80s and 90s but do just fine at room temps in the 70s. Much colder than that may slow them down though.
